The big man for UK (Noels?) had a lot to do with how bad Ole Miss looked. He pretty much neutralized our two big men (Holloway and Buckner) when he was in the game.

Ole Miss made a big run on the cats late in the second half, pulling to within a point, mostly while the UK big man was sitting on the pine with 4 fouls. Once Noels was back in the game, he picked up where he left off. Personally, I thought that he should have fouled out on several occasions before UK had an opportunity to rebuild their lead ---eg he mugged Holloway on an attempted dunk, and pushed Jones down from behind (which btw, resulted in a season ending injury to Jones). Once it became clear that the refs were not going to call that 5th foul on him, Noels got bolder and bolder. And that was that. He was the difference in the game (along with the big white boy from UK who filled up the basket).

Only White shot well from the floor. Henderson had a "bad night" shooting the ball from the floor, and still scored 21 points, mainly from free throws (along with getting some rebounds, steals, drawing fouls, and feeding his teammates the ball for easy shots). We needed our normal contributions from Holloway and Buckner --- but as stated above, they were effectively taken out of the game offensively by the UK big man.

UK has more "talent" than any of the SEC schools. But, much of that talent is very young and inexperienced at the college level. As I indicated in another thread, I look for UK to continue to get better and better as the season goes.

The Rebs got off to a great start this season, but will no doubt have some bumps in the road. The UK loss was one of them. The upcoming game with Florida will likely be the next bump. It will be interesting to see how the Rebels rebound from some adversity --- losing a game or two --- Henderson in a shooting slump(for him) --- bad PR re Henderson ---- injuries to Jones and Nick Williams, etc. If the Rebels can pull together and overcome these obstacles, they still have a great chance to reach the NCAA tournament.
